I got to ride the nytro v3 for the first time.
I have no affiliation . the Price was good and I gave it a try.
wind was flukey from 15 to 25.
I weigh 68 kg.
ride since 2006.
134 x 34 board
22 m lines
45cm bar switch v1 bar
Construction is top notch!
turning: what i like the most is that the power thru the turns are smooth and constant.
much different from my 9m bow that has a delay built into it.
the kite is considered médium turning speed but i consider it fast for my taste .
kite drifts very well when depowered and very stable.
feedback on the lines is good,and it lets you know where the kite is all the time without looking.
kite tended to backstall on 15 knots.
this kite shines on upwind 18 knots and up an its a rocket.
Gave 2 jumps one i droped like a rock due to lull and the other i floated nice.
floaty ellevation not jerky like a c.
overall very nice kite!!
1 hour test.

Got to ride another sesión.
90 minutes.
18 to 22 Knots gusting to 25 with 27 meter lines
55 cms bar
134 x 34 board
hot wind in a lake.
dedicated this sesión to jumps and hooked kiteloops.
Got the timming right on the kite and trimming is most important.
Kite picks speed very fast.
awesome for sending the kite fast and geting air.
In Kiteloops i find it a fast looping kite.
you give it a fast tug on the sterring and the kite spins almost on its axis.
its funny feeling compared to my previous 9m that it took about a second to respond.
the loop is smooth and kite is very managable.
i sure dont megaloop but its nice to feel control when doing a kiteloop.
kite has enough pull (feedback on bar)to tell you exactly where it is no need to look.
i guess thats the no pulley thing. first time for me.
found the bar to get a Little heavier on the gusts.
at the end of the sesión i was elbow and arm tired but maybe i was holding on to the bar to agresive due to jumps and kiteloop.
will see on next sessions on the sea
4:thumb: out of five.

Yes like all kites of this nature, I found it to fly a lot on the front lines. While the bar pressure is meduim (spot on for feedback), to turn it does take more input. Once initiated though a quick looping kite. Saw a local here going very big the other day (we were egging him on as he was last out on the water and the wind had kicked up a fair bit... Good fun). Yeh it's got some power under the hood, flies as I said on the front lines a fair bit, but you wanna go big and not be on a race kite (or a loaded fifth aka the rebel) with four lines and some C in it, this is what you have to deal with. Decent kite in this genre hey.
